Warning Signs You Need Stucco Water Damage Repair

Ignoring stucco water damage can lead to costly repairs, health hazards, and even structural instability. Here are some common warning signs that you need stucco water damage repair: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

If you notice a persistent musty smell in your home, it could be a sign of hidden moisture and water damage. Don’t ignore this warning sign, as it can lead to mold growth and health hazards.

Water Stains and Discoloration

Water stains and discoloration on your walls, ceilings, or floors can show water damage and the need for repair. Don’t wait to address this issue, as it can spread and cause further damage.

Warped or Buckled Stucco

Warped or buckled stucco can be a sign of water damage and the need for repair. Don’t delay in addressing this issue, as it can lead to structural instability and further damage.

Peeling or Cracking Paint

Peeling or cracking paint can show water damage and the need for repair. Don’t ignore this warning sign, as it can lead to further damage and health hazards.

Unusual Sounds or Leaks

Unusual sounds or leaks in your home can show water damage and the need for repair. Don’t wait to address this issue, as it can lead to further damage and health hazards.

High Humidity Levels

High humidity levels in your home can show water damage and the need for repair. Don’t ignore this warning sign, as it can lead to mold growth and health hazards.

Stucco Water Damage Repair v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small water leak, less than 10 sq. Ft. Yes No You can likely fix it yourself with a DIY repair kit.
Large water leak, over 100 sq. Ft. No Yes It’s too extensive for a DIY repair and needs professional expertise.
Hidden water damage behind walls or ceilings. No Yes You can’t see the damage, and it needs specialized equipment to detect and repair.
Structural damage to stucco or surrounding areas. No Yes It needs professional expertise to repair and prevent further damage.
Water damage caused by flooding or sewage backup. No Yes It’s a biohazard, and you need professional equipment and expertise to handle the situation.
Water damage in a crawl space or attic. No Yes It’s difficult to access, and you need professional expertise to repair and prevent further damage.

Common Questions About Stucco Water Damage Repair

What causes stucco water damage?

Stucco water damage can be caused by a variety of factors, including heavy rainfall, flooding, burst pipes, and leaks in your home’s plumbing system. Regular maintenance and inspections can help prevent stucco water damage.

How long does stucco water damage repair take?

The length of time it takes to repair stucco water damage depends on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. Our team typically completes repairs within 3-5 days, but this can vary depending on the specific needs of your property.

Is stucco water damage repair covered by insurance?

Yes, stucco water damage repair is typically covered by insurance, but the specifics depend on your policy and the cause of the damage. We’ll work closely with your insurance provider to ensure a smooth claims process.

Can I prevent stucco water damage?

Yes, regular maintenance and inspections can help prevent stucco water damage. We recommend regular checks on your home’s plumbing system and roof to ensure that they’re in good working condition.

What are the risks of ignoring stucco water damage?

Ignoring stucco water damage can lead to costly repairs, health hazards, and even structural instability. Don’t wait to address this issue, as it can spread and cause further damage.
